Stunning Views Await

Upon arriving at the Panoramique du Mont Saint-Clair, the panoramic views are immediately captivating. The hill offers a sweeping perspective of Sète, where the azure waters of the Mediterranean meet the shoreline dotted with colorful houses. The sight of boats gliding across the harbor adds to the charm, while the backdrop of distant mountains creates a picturesque scene that seems to be pulled straight from a postcard.
